Owen Sound - October 29, 2013 - Owen Sound Attack General Manager Dale DeGray is announcing that the club has acquired forward Brett Hargrave from the Sarnia Sting in exchange for a 2nd Round Draft Choice in 2016, Windsor’s 3rd Round Draft Choice in 2017 and a 4th Round Draft Choice in 2014. There is a condition whereby the 2016 2nd Round Draft Choice will turn in to a 2014 2nd Round Draft Choice should the Attack acquire a 2014 2nd Round Draft Pick before the trade deadline.

Coming to the Attack is seventeen year old Brett Hargrave. Hargrave was a 1st Round Draft Pick of the Sting in 2012, 13th overall. The 6’4, 205lb winger notched 6 goals and 5 assists in his rookie year in 2012/2013 and had a goal and three assists in nine games this season before going home to await a trade. During last year’s World U17 Challenge, the North Bay native had 2 goals and 3 assists in 5 games for Team Ontario.

“During Brett’s draft year we saw a lot of qualities that appealed to us.”, said DeGray. “He is a big winger and we feel he will help our club this year and in the coming years. We’d like to welcome Brett and his family into the Attack organization.”
